Cartoon Network and Disney XD—formerly Toon Disney—are adding live-action shows to attract boy viewers, USA Today says. “Animation as a genre channel seemed to be very limiting,” Disney Channel Worldwide chief Rich Ross tells the paper. “We had an opportunity to broaden our voice to get more kids, and certainly boys, by reengineering what Toon Disney was.”
